Just an FYI: do not use white to mix lighter colors. This isnt gouache. With watercolors you just add more water to make the colors lighter. For anyone who watches this now.

@bettyvanwhite674511 ай бұрын
This was helpful until I got to the flipping horizontally and vertically. My results were not like yours. Top right box should be flipped once horizontally, bottom right box should be flipped horizontally and vertically and bottom left just once vertically. I've tried several times and isn't working. I'm using AD2 on Ipad. Do I have a setting somewhere that isn't right?
@maureenrooney88136 ай бұрын
i found that too, i drew a triangle then flipped to see how they match up.
